SQL Maestro Group announces the release of Data Wizard for MySQL 9.12,
a powerful Windows GUI solution for MySQL data management.

Data Wizard for MySQL provides you with a number of easy-to-use
wizards to convert any ADO-compatible database to the MySQL database,
import data into MySQL tables, export data from tables, views and
queries to most popular file formats as well as generate data-driven
ASP.NET pages for your MySQL database.

New features
=================

1. Data Import: now you can import data from XML, Microsoft Office
Excel 2007 and Microsoft Office Access 2007 file formats along with
Microsoft Office Excel 97-2003, Microsoft Office Access, CSV, DBF, and
Text files supported in the previous versions. Also starting with this
version you can import Text and CSV data files stored in different
encodings.

2. Data Import: now it is possible to empty target tables as well as
execute custom SQL scripts before and after the import.

3. Data Import: an ability of using the LOAD DATA INFILE command has
been implemented. This feature can speed up the import process up to
10 times.

4. Data Import: the wizard has been completely redesigned to improve
the look and feel and increase the usability.

5. Data Export: support for Microsoft Office Excel 2007, Microsoft
Office Word 2007, OpenDocument Spreadsheed, and OpenDocument Text file
formats has been implemented. Also now it is possible to select the
result file encoding. This wizard also has been completely redesigned.

6. Datapump: the conversion rules for fields and indexes become more
intelligent, so starting with this version most of source databases
from well-known DBMS can be transferred even with default settings (or
with a small customization). Also the speed of data transfer has been
significantly increased.

7. Starting with this version it is possible to connect to a remote
server via SSH tunnel using a key-based authentication (in addition to
the password-based authentication supported in the previous versions).
To establish a remote connection in this way, you have to provide a
private key (either in ssh.com or OpenSSH formats) and (optionally) a
passphrase. This version also introduces support for both SSH-1 and
SSH-2 protocols (whereas all the previous versions supported only
SSH-1).

8. An Italian localization is now included into the installation package.
